Database of the Month: Sports Market Analytics (SMA)

By Dominique Winn

Answering questions about sports as a business and analyzing consumer information relevant to sports are easy and fun tasks with Sports Market Analytics. Formerly called SBRNet, Sports Market Analytics (SMA) delivers industry news, summaries, metrics, articles and statistics about sports through a user-friendly and well-developed site. Summer Students, the Writing Center & ESOL Center are Here to Help!

By Lisa Curtin

Bentley University's ESOL (English for Speakers of Other Languages) Center and Writing Center are now open and accepting appointments from all undergraduate and graduate students enrolled in summer session classes. Walk-ins are welcome (please check their hours before dropping in), but appointments are strongly encouraged. Use the appointment links provided below. Both centers are located on the lower level of the library. Please note that this summer the Writing Center is offering online (synchronous) assistance!

Bentley Library Top 10 Most Popular Books, DVDs & Audiobooks of 2017/18

By Lisa Curtin
Welcome to the 9th annual Bentley Library Top 10! 

At the end of every academic year we rank the library’s most popular books, audiobooks, DVDs, and OverDrive downloadable ebooks and audiobooks based on the number of times they have been borrowed (excluding items placed on reserve for a class).
